The Lab Mailers Market is a specialized segment within the broader packaging industry, focusing on the production and distribution of protective mailers designed for the safe transport of laboratory samples, diagnostic specimens, and other sensitive materials. These mailers are engineered to meet stringent regulatory requirements, including those set by organizations like the International Air Transport Association (IATA) and the Department of Transportation (DOT), ensuring compliance and safety during transit. The market serves a diverse range of end-users, including clinical laboratories, research institutions, pharmaceutical companies, and healthcare facilities, all of which rely on these packaging solutions to maintain sample integrity and prevent contamination. Key materials commonly used in the manufacture of lab mailers include durable plastics, corrugated fiberboard, and absorbent materials, often incorporating features such as leak-proof seals, cushioning, and tamper-evident closures. The demand for lab mailers is closely tied to the growth in biomedical research, clinical diagnostics, and the global healthcare supply chain, with an increasing emphasis on sustainability driving innovation in recyclable and biodegradable options. The Lab Mailers Market can be segmented based on type, primarily into rigid mailers and flexible mailers, each catering to different application needs and material requirements. Rigid mailers, often constructed from corrugated fiberboard or hard plastics, provide superior protection for fragile or high-value items, making them ideal for shipping diagnostic equipment, glassware, or sensitive instruments. These mailers typically feature reinforced edges, cushioning inserts, and secure closure mechanisms to prevent damage during transit. Flexible mailers, on the other hand, are made from materials like polyethylene or polypropylene and are designed for lighter, less fragile items such as documents, non-hazardous samples, or swabs. They offer advantages in terms of weight reduction, cost efficiency, and ease of storage, often incorporating features like self-sealing adhesives, tear-notches, and waterproof barriers. Within these categories, further differentiation exists based on specific properties, such as insulated mailers for temperature-sensitive shipments or absorbent mailers for liquid-containing samples. The choice between rigid and flexible mailers depends on factors like the nature of the contents, regulatory requirements, shipping distance, and cost considerations, with manufacturers offering a range of options to meet diverse customer needs.
Application insights for the Lab Mailers Market reveal a diverse range of uses across various industries, with the healthcare and life sciences sectors being the primary drivers. In clinical laboratories, lab mailers are essential for transporting patient samples, such as blood, urine, and tissue specimens, to testing facilities while maintaining sample integrity and preventing contamination. Pharmaceutical companies utilize these mailers for shipping drug samples, clinical trial materials, and regulatory submissions, ensuring compliance with good distribution practices and safety standards. Research institutions and academic laboratories rely on lab mailers for sending biological materials, reagents, and experimental samples between facilities, often requiring specialized packaging for hazardous or perishable items. Additionally, the diagnostic industry uses lab mailers for at-home test kits and collection devices, which have seen increased demand due to trends in personalized medicine and remote healthcare. Other applications include use in veterinary services for animal sample transport and in industrial settings for shipping quality control samples. The versatility of lab mailers allows them to be tailored to specific application requirements, with features such as tamper-evidence, temperature control, and cushioning being critical for different use cases.

What are lab mailers used for? Lab mailers are specialized packaging solutions designed for the safe and compliant transport of laboratory samples, diagnostic specimens, and other sensitive materials, ensuring integrity and preventing contamination during transit.
What materials are commonly used in lab mailers? Common materials include durable plastics like polyethylene and polypropylene, corrugated fiberboard for rigid options, and absorbent materials for liquid containment, often incorporating features such as leak-proof seals and cushioning.
Are lab mailers reusable? While some lab mailers are designed for single use due to regulatory and contamination concerns, there are reusable options available, typically made from sterilizable materials, though their adoption depends on specific application requirements and sustainability goals.
How do lab mailers ensure regulatory compliance? Lab mailers are manufactured to meet standards set by organizations like IATA and DOT, involving rigorous testing for durability, leak resistance, and labeling, ensuring safe transport of hazardous or infectious materials.
Can lab mailers be customized? Yes, many manufacturers offer customization options, including size variations, branding, and specific protective features, tailored to meet the unique needs of different industries and applications.
What are the trends in sustainable lab mailers? Trends include the development of mailers made from recycled or biodegradable materials, reducing environmental impact while maintaining performance, driven by increasing corporate and consumer focus on sustainability.
